Method and system for creating a unique identifier
First Claim
1. A method of creating a second unique identifier based on a first unique identifier, the method comprising:
- receiving, by a second system from a user terminal operated by a user, the first unique identifier, wherein the first unique identifier is a primary account number;
identifying, by the second system, a first system based on the first unique identifier, the first system being different from the user terminal;
initiating, by the second system, a first authentication process based on the first unique identifier; and
responsive to the user successfully authenticating during the first authentication process;
receiving, by the second system, user data from the first system;
generating, by the second system, based on at least a part of the user data associated with the first unique identifier in the first system, at least a part of the second unique identifier, the second unique identifier being different from the first unique identifier;
storing, by the second system, the first unique identifier;
receiving, by the second system, the second unique identifier from the user terminal; and
initiating, by the second system, a payment transaction using the stored first unique identifier and the at least part of the user data.
2 Assignments
0 Petitions
Accused Products
Abstract
Method and apparatus for creating a second unique identifier for a user in a second system based on a first unique identifier for a user in a first system. A first authentication process is initiated based on a first unique identifier associated with the user in the first system. Responsive to the user successfully authenticating during the first authentication process, the second unique identifier for a user in the second system is generated. The second unique identifier is based on user data associated with the first unique identifier in the first system, and the second unique identifier is different from the first unique identifier.
-
Citations
17 Claims
-
1. A method of creating a second unique identifier based on a first unique identifier, the method comprising:
-
receiving, by a second system from a user terminal operated by a user, the first unique identifier, wherein the first unique identifier is a primary account number; identifying, by the second system, a first system based on the first unique identifier, the first system being different from the user terminal; initiating, by the second system, a first authentication process based on the first unique identifier; and responsive to the user successfully authenticating during the first authentication process; receiving, by the second system, user data from the first system; generating, by the second system, based on at least a part of the user data associated with the first unique identifier in the first system, at least a part of the second unique identifier, the second unique identifier being different from the first unique identifier; storing, by the second system, the first unique identifier; receiving, by the second system, the second unique identifier from the user terminal; and initiating, by the second system, a payment transaction using the stored first unique identifier and the at least part of the user data.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15)
-
-
16. Apparatus for creating a second unique identifier based on a first unique identifier, the apparatus comprising at least one memory including computer program code, and at least one processor in data communication with the at least one memory, wherein the at least one processor is configured to:
-
receive, from a user terminal operated by a user, the first unique identifier, wherein the first unique identifier is a primary account number; identify a first system based on the first unique identifier, the first system being different from the user terminal; initiate a first authentication process based on the first unique identifier; and responsive to the user successfully authenticating during the first authentication process; receive user data from the first system; generate, by a second system, based on at least a part of the user data associated with the first unique identifier in the first system, at least a part of the second unique identifier, the second unique identifier being different from the first unique identifier; storing, by the second system, the first unique identifier; receiving, by the second system, the second unique identifier from the user terminal; and initiating, a payment transaction using the stored first unique identifier and the at least part of the user data.
-
-
17. A non-transitory computer-readable medium comprising computer-executable instructions which, when executed by a processor, cause a computing device to perform a method of creating a second unique identifier based on a first unique identifier, the method comprising:
-
receiving, by a second system from a user terminal operated by a user, the first unique identifier, wherein the first unique identifier is a primary account number; identifying a first system based on the first unique identifier, the first system being different from the user terminal; initiating a first authentication process based on the first unique identifier; and responsive to the user successfully authenticating during the first authentication process; receiving, by the second system, user data from the first system; generating, by the second system, based on at least a part of the user data associated with the first unique identifier in the first system, at least a part of the second unique identifier, the second unique identifier being different from the first unique identifier storing, by the second system, the first unique identifier; receiving, by the second system, the second unique identifier from the user terminal; and initiating, by the second system, a payment transaction using the stored first unique identifier and the at least part of the user data.
-
Specification